Coorparoo is an inner south-east Brisbane suburb, around 4 km from the city centre, with a well-loved blend of heritage charm and modern convenience. Its hilly, leafy streets are lined with character homes, and recent years have brought new development around the Coorparoo Square precinct. The suburb borders Camp Hill, Greenslopes, Stones Corner and Norman Park, and main roads such as Old Cleveland Road and Cavendish Road keep it closely connected to the rest of the inner south.
Coorparoo offers strong everyday amenity for people living with disability, with shops, allied health services and community spaces close at hand. The Eastern Busway along Old Cleveland Road provides quick, frequent connections to the CBD, while the railway station adds another option for getting to appointments and activities. Princess Alexandra Hospital at nearby Woolloongabba is only a short trip away. Footpaths, local parks and a busy village atmosphere make it easier for residents to stay active and involved in community life.

Local information
- Nearest hospital Princess Alexandra Hospital at Woolloongabba, roughly 3 km away
- Public transport Coorparoo railway station serves the suburb on the Cleveland line, and the Eastern Busway along Old Cleveland Road provides fast, frequent bus connections to the CBD.
- Local government area Brisbane City Council
